    G J LUPTON V THE COMMISSIONER OF INLAND REVENUE DEPARTMENT HC WN CIV 2008-485-2460

    Citation
    openlaw-2d02912d_5aad_43d6_b415_4623366da7d2.pdf
    Court
    High Court

    The Court found on the balance of probabilities that, except for the AUD$215,000 received via Honshu Pty, the deposits and transfers through Scorelink, Customer Direct, GT Agents/Clydesdale, GT Investments/Global and payments to the plaintiff's personal account were derived by the plaintiff and constituted assessable income; the plaintiff's evidence was largely not credible or reliable; the AUD$215,000 was a capital repayment/proceeds and not taxable; because the plaintiff took deliberate steps to conceal income via corporate/trust structures the evasion shortfall penalty under s141E is impos…
